Apple TV+ Bitrate Highest Among All Streaming Services, Offers Best Video Quality For 4K

November 5, 2019 by Natividad Sidlangan Leave a Comment

Apple TV+ has just been released recently but it has already taken some thrones in the streaming service industry. Reports and tests indicate that the Apple TV+ bitrate is actually the highest among all existing streaming services at the moment.
